attempt this "decisive dozen" time line: a million. September 1939 Germany assaults Poland. 2. would-June 1940 Germany defeats France. 3. September 1940 Germany fails to defeat England. 4. June 1941 Germany assaults Russia. 5. December 1941 Germans halted in the past Moscow. 6. December 1941 Japan assaults the U. S. and different allies. 7. June 1942 jap defeated at halfway Island. 8. January 1943 Germans smashed at Stalingrad. 9. July 1943 Germans overwhelmed at Kursk. 10. June-July 1944 Normandy landings, liberation of France. 11. would 1945 Germany surrenders. 12. August-September 1945 Atom bombs fall, Japan surrenders.
